Title

40 Gbit/s demultiplexing experiment with 10 GHz all-optical clock recovery using a modelocked semiconductor laser

Abstract
A 40 Gbit/s time-division multiplexed signal was demultiplexed to 10 Gbit/s using a single modelocked semiconductor laser as the clock source. The pulses of the laser directly control an all-optical switch for demultiplexing.
